Barbados Joe Walcott


Joe Walcott, also known as Barbados Joe Walcott to distinguish him from the American known by the same name, was a Barbadian boxer who held the World Welterweight Title. Nicknamed The Barbados Demon Walcott, who stood 51 tall, was a formidable fighter who fought from 1890 to 1911. Barbados Joe Walcott was the idol of the more contemporary boxer Jersey Joe Walcott, who chose to use his idols name as his own ring name in his honor.
